manipulator
|
effect
|
|---|---|
|
Sets
only the format flags specified by n. Setting remains in effect until the next
change, like
ios::setf( ).
|
|
|
Clears
only the format flags specified by n. Setting remains in effect until the next
change, like
ios::unsetf( ).
|
|
|
Changes
base to n, where n is 10, 8, or 16. (Anything else results in 0.) If n is zero,
output is base 10, but input uses the C conventions: 10 is 10, 010 is 8, and
0xf is 15. You might as well use
dec,
oct,
and
hex
for output.
|
|
|
Changes
the fill character to n, like
ios::fill( ).
|
|
|
Changes
the precision to n, like
ios::precision( ).
|
|
|
Changes
the field width to n, like
ios::width( ).
|
//: C18:Manips.cpp
// Format.cpp using manipulators
#include <fstream>
#include <iomanip>
using namespace std;
int main() {
ofstream trc("trace.out");
int i = 47;
float f = 2300114.414159;
char* s = "Is there any more?";
trc << setiosflags(
ios::unitbuf /*| ios::stdio */ /// ?????
| ios::showbase | ios::uppercase
| ios::showpos);
trc << i << endl; // Default to dec
trc << hex << i << endl;
trc << resetiosflags(ios::uppercase)
<< oct << i << endl;
trc.setf(ios::left, ios::adjustfield);
trc << resetiosflags(ios::showbase)
<< dec << setfill('0');
trc << "fill char: " << trc.fill() << endl;
trc << setw(10) << i << endl;
trc.setf(ios::right, ios::adjustfield);
trc << setw(10) << i << endl;
trc.setf(ios::internal, ios::adjustfield);
trc << setw(10) << i << endl;
trc << i << endl; // Without setw(10)
trc << resetiosflags(ios::showpos)
<< setiosflags(ios::showpoint)
<< "prec = " << trc.precision() << endl;
trc.setf(ios::scientific, ios::floatfield);
trc << f << endl;
trc.setf(ios::fixed, ios::floatfield);
trc << f << endl;
trc.setf(0, ios::floatfield); // Automatic
trc << f << endl;
trc << setprecision(20);
trc << "prec = " << trc.precision() << endl;
trc << f << endl;
trc.setf(ios::scientific, ios::floatfield);
trc << f << endl;
trc.setf(ios::fixed, ios::floatfield);
trc << f << endl;
trc.setf(0, ios::floatfield); // Automatic
trc << f << endl;
trc << setw(10) << s << endl;
trc << setw(40) << s << endl;
trc.setf(ios::left, ios::adjustfield);
trc << setw(40) << s << endl;
trc << resetiosflags(
ios::showpoint | ios::unitbuf
// | ios::stdio // ?????????
);
